Open-loop gain AOLA_\text{OL} of real op-amp

Around 10610^6

Input resistance RinR_\text{in} of real op-amp

Up to 1012Ω10^{12} \, \Omega

Output resistance RoutR_\text{out} of real op-amp

Around 100Ω100 \, \Omega

Open-loop bandwidth of real op-amp

Around 1515 Hz

Closed-loop bandwidth of real op-amp

Up to 2.52.5 MHz

Current scale drawn by real op-amp input

Nanoamperes

Offset voltage in real op-amp

Small non-zero output when both inputs are grounded

Purpose of offset nulling

To calibrate device and counter offset voltage

Gain-bandwidth product relationship

gain×bandwidth=constant\text{gain} \times \text{bandwidth} = \text{constant}

Effect of increasing gain on bandwidth

Reduces available bandwidth
